Consider the transformer in Figure 3.25
.
Suppose the load is a resistor R and that the transformer is ideal, with M2 = LS LP and all magnetic flux lines passing through both inductors. Show that the voltage drop across the resistor is VS = ?LS /LPVP = NS VP/NP and that the time-averaged power consumed in the resistor is P = (LS /LP)(V2P/2R) = N2S V2P/2N2PR.
